Nowon-gu sits at the far northeastern edge of Seoul, up against the mountains and the Gyeonggi border. It is Seoul's most densely populated district and one of its most affordable, built out in the 1980s as a large planned apartment zone rather than an old commercial center. The character is plainly residential: more than 80% of housing is apartments, and Nowon ranks first among Seoul's 25 districts in total apartment units. It is also a well-known education district for northern Seoul, with a heavy concentration of schools, hagwon (cram schools), and universities. It is not a nightlife or business hub, and it is far from the international-office and embassy clusters of Gangnam and central Seoul.

การเดินทาง

Nowon is well covered by three Seoul Metro lines, with Nowon Station (Lines 4 and 7) as the main transfer hub and commercial center. Line 7 runs the length of the district and connects toward Gangnam without a transfer; Line 4 heads down toward central Seoul and Myeongdong; Line 6 serves the southern edge around Taereung and Hwarangdae. The Gyeongchun Line (toward Chuncheon) also stops at Kwangwoon University Station. The trade-off is distance: because Nowon is at the top of the network, commutes into central Seoul or Gangnam typically run 40-60 minutes, so many residents choose it for lower rent and accept a longer ride.

No direct airport rail line. Reaching Incheon International Airport means transferring to the AREX airport train (via Seoul Station) or taking a limited-stop airport bus; plan on roughly 90 minutes to Incheon.

ใครอาศัยอยู่ที่นี่

Nowon is a quiet, family-oriented commuter district rather than a destination. Its identity is affordability and education: it is consistently listed among Seoul's cheapest districts to rent or buy, and the Junggye-dong and Sanggye-dong areas are known citywide for their density of hagwon, earning Nowon a reputation as the 'education district' of northern Seoul. Streets are dominated by 1980s-90s apartment complexes, everyday shopping, and schools. It is close to mountains (Suraksan, Bukhansan foothills) and parks, which suits families and students who want space and calm over a central, walkable-nightlife lifestyle. Do not expect an international or upscale scene here — it is a solidly local, middle- and working-class residential area.

  • Nowon Station areaThe district's busiest commercial center: department store, shopping, restaurants, and the main transit hub
  • Junggye-dongBest known for its concentrated hagwon (cram-school) district serving families focused on education
  • Sanggye-dongLarge planned apartment area to the north; affordable, dense family housing
  • Gongneung-dongUniversity belt around SeoulTech and Kwangwoon; more student housing and cheaper rentals
  • Wolgye / SeokgyeSouthern edge near Line 1/6; older neighborhoods and the gateway toward central Seoul

สำหรับผู้พำนักชาวต่างชาติ

Nowon is a genuine university belt, which is its main draw for foreigners — it hosts several campuses, so international students and university staff are the most common expat residents. Rents are among the lowest in Seoul, with entry-level studios and one-bedrooms often in the ~600,000-1,200,000 KRW/month range (excluding deposit), making it attractive for students and budget-conscious newcomers. The trade-offs: it is far from central Seoul and Gangnam, English-language services and international grocers are limited compared with Yongsan or Gangnam, and the area is oriented toward Korean families rather than an international community. Best suited to those tied to one of its universities or prioritizing low rent over a short commute.

มหาวิทยาลัยในเขตและบริเวณใกล้เคียง

  • Seoul National University of Science and Technology (SeoulTech)National university; large campus in Gongneung-dong
  • Kwangwoon UniversityPrivate research university near Kwangwoon University Station
  • Seoul Women's UniversityPrivate women's university
  • Sahmyook UniversityPrivate Christian university in the north of the district
  • Induk UniversityPrivate college
